Shloka 10

Jarāsandha as Obstacle to the Rājasūya — Kṛṣṇa’s Strategic Genealogical Brief

Sabhā Parva, Adhyāya 13

परिग्रहान्नरेन्द्रस्य भीमस्य परिपालनात्‌ । शत्रूणां क्षपणाच्चैव बीभत्सो: सव्यसाचिन:,निकामवर्षा: स्फीताश्न आसञ्जनपदास्तथा । महाराज युधिष्ठिर सबको आत्मीयजनोंकी भाँति अपनाते, भीमसेन सबकी रक्षा करते, सव्यसाची अर्जुन शत्रुओंके संहारमें लगे रहते, बुद्धिमान्‌ सहदेव सबको धर्मका उपदेश दिया करते और नकुल स्वभावसे ही सबके साथ विनयपूर्ण बर्ताव करते थे। इससे उनके राज्यके सभी जनपद कलहशून्य, निर्भय, स्वधर्मपरायण तथा उन्नतिशील थे। वहाँ उनकी इच्छाके अनुसार समयपर वर्षा होती थी

parigrahān narendrasya bhīmasya paripālanāt | śatrūṇāṃ kṣapaṇāc caiva bībhatsaḥ savyasācinaḥ || nikāmavarṣāḥ sphītāś ca āsañjanapadās tathā | mahārāja yudhiṣṭhiraḥ sarvān ātmīyajanān iva abhyagṛhṇāt, bhīmasenaḥ sarveṣāṃ rakṣāṃ karoti, savyasācī arjunaḥ śatrūṇāṃ saṃhāre lagnaḥ, buddhimān sahadevaḥ sarvān dharmam upadiśati, nakulaś ca svabhāvena sarvaiḥ saha vinayapūrvaṃ vyavaharati; ataḥ tasya rājyasya sarve janapadāḥ kalahāśūnyāḥ, nirbhayāḥ, svadharmaparāyaṇāḥ tathā unnatiśīlāḥ; tatra ca yathākāmaṃ kāle kāle varṣā bhavanti.

Vaiśampāyana nói: Nhờ nhà vua trị vì với sự tiết chế công chính; nhờ Bhīma che chở dân chúng; và nhờ Arjuna—đáng sợ nơi chiến địa, thiện xạ dùng được cả hai tay—không ngừng tiêu diệt kẻ thù, vương quốc ấy trở nên hưng thịnh. Dưới triều Mahārāja Yudhiṣṭhira, mọi người được ôm ấp như ruột thịt; Bhīmasena làm tấm khiên của dân; Savyasācī Arjuna chuyên tâm dẹp yên các thế lực đối nghịch; Sahadeva trí tuệ luôn giảng dạy dharma cho mọi người; còn Nakula, vốn tính khiêm cung, đối đãi với ai cũng nhã nhặn. Bởi vậy các xứ trong nước không có tranh chấp, không sợ hãi, tận tụy với bổn phận của mình và ngày càng tiến bộ; mưa cũng đến đúng mùa, như lòng người mong ước.

Educational Q&A

A stable and prosperous kingdom arises when each leader fulfills a complementary dharmic role: the king governs with restraint and fairness, protectors ensure public safety, defenders neutralize threats, the wise teach dharma, and the courteous maintain social cohesion—resulting in harmony, security, and even nature’s cooperation through timely rains.

Vaiśampāyana describes the well-ordered state under Yudhiṣṭhira: he treats all as his own, Bhīma safeguards the people, Arjuna suppresses enemies, Sahadeva gives dharma-instruction, and Nakula behaves with humility; consequently the provinces are peaceful, fearless, dutiful, and prosperous, with rains arriving in season.
